A quantitative PCR approach for determining the ribosomal DNA copy number in the genome of Agave tequila Weber Electron. J. Biotechnol.
Rubio-Piña,Jorge; Quiroz-Moreno,Adriana; Sánchez-Teyer,L. Felipe.
Background: Agave tequilana has a great economic importance in Mexico in order to produce alcoholic beverages and bioenergy. However, in this species the structure and organization of the rDNAs in the genome are limited, and it represents an obstacle both in their genetic research and improvement as well. rDNA copy number variations per eukaryotic genome have been considered as a source of genetic rearrangements. In this study, the copy number of 18S and 5S rDNAs in the A. tequilana genome was estimated, and an absolute quantitative qPCR assay and genome size was used. In addition, an association between the rDNAs copy number and physical mapping was performed to confirm our results. Results: The analysis were successfully applied to determine copy number...

A remarkable autosomal heteromorphism in Pseudoryzomys simplex 2n = 56; FN = 54-55 (Rodentia, Sigmodontinae) Genet. Mol. Biol.
Moreira,Camila Nascimento; Di-Nizo,Camilla Bruno; Silva,Maria José de Jesus; Yonenaga-Yassuda,Yatiyo; Ventura,Karen.
Pseudoryzomys simplex, the false rice rat, is a monotypic genus of the Oryzomyini tribe (Sigmodontinae) distributed in part of Bolivia, Paraguay, Argentina and Brazil. Its diploid number has been described as 56 acrocentric chromosomes decreasing in size and no karyotype figure has been depicted. Herein, we present karyotypic data on P. simplex, including chromosome banding and molecular fluorescent in situ hybridization using telomeric sequences and the whole X-chromosome of its sister clade Holochilus brasiliensis (HBR) as probes. A case of remarkable autosomal heteromorphism due to the presence of a whole heterochromatic arm leading to the variability of FN is reported, as well as the occurrence of regions of homology between the X and Y chromosomes...

Chromosome divergence and NOR polymorphism in Bryconamericus aff. iheringii (Teleostei, Characidae) in the hydrographic systems of the Paranapanema and Ivaí Rivers, Paraná, Brazil Genet. Mol. Biol.
Capistano,Thiago Gomes; Castro,Ana Luiza de Brito Portela; Julio-Junior,Horácio Ferreira.
Cytogenetic studies were carried out in three populations of Bryconamericus aff. iheringii from two hydrographic systems of the Paranapanema and Ivaí Rivers, separated by a watershed, both belonging to the upper Paraná River basin. Specimens had a constant diploid number 2n = 52 chromosomes. However, three karyotype formulae were identified in the three populations: B. aff. iheringii from the Maringá stream had 12M+18SM+8ST+14A (FN = 90); specimens from Keller River showed 8M+28SM+6ST+10A (FN = 94) and specimens from the Tatupeba stream had 8M+20SM+8ST+16A (FN = 88). Nucleolar organizer regions (NORs) were identified by silver nitrate staining and fluorescent in situ hybridization (FISH) with an 18S rDNA probe. Specimens from Tatupeba stream had a simple...

Comparative analyses of three swallow species (Aves, Passeriformes, Hirundinidae): Insights on karyotype evolution and genomic organization Genet. Mol. Biol.
Barcellos,Suziane Alves; Kretschmer,Rafael; Souza,Marcelo Santos de; Costa,Alice Lemos; Degrandi,Tiago Marafiga; Lopes,Cassiane Furlan; Ferguson-Smith,Malcolm A.; Pereira,Jorge; Oliveira,Edivaldo Herculano Correa de; Gunski,Ricardo José; Garnero,Analía del Valle.
Abstract Despite the richness of species in the Hirudinidae family, little is known about the genome organization of swallows. The Progne tapera species presents genetic and morphological difference when compared to other members of the same genus. Hence, the aims of this study were to analyze the chromosomal evolution of three species Progne tapera, Progne chalybea and Pygochelidon cyanoleuca - by comparative chromosome painting using two sets of probes, Gallus gallus and Zenaida auriculata, in order to determine chromosome homologies and the relationship between these species. All karyotypes exhibited 76 chromosomes with similar morphology, except for the 5th, 6th and 7th chromosome pairs in P. cyanoleuca. Additionally, comparative chromosome painting...

Effect of cycle time and airflow in biological nitrogen removal from poultry slaughterhouse wastewater using sequencing batch reactor REA
Lopes,Carla L.; Mees,Juliana B. R.; Sene,Luciane; Carvalho,Karina Q. de; Christ,Divair; Gomes,Simone D..
This study aimed to evaluate the influence of airflow (0.25, 0.50 and 0.75 L.L-1.min-1) and cycle time (10.45 h, 14.25 h and 17.35 h) on a sequencing batch reactor (SBR) performance in promoting nitrification and denitrification of poultry slaughterhouse wastewater. The operational stages included feeding, aerobic and anoxic reactions, sedimentation and discharge. SBR was operated in a laboratory scale with a working volume of 4 L, keeping 25% of biomass retained inside the reactor as inoculum for the next batch. In the anoxic stage, C: N ratio was maintained between 5 and 6 by adding cassava starch wastewater. A factorial design (22) with five repetitions was designed at the central point to evaluate the influence of cycle time and airflow on total...

Karyotypic diversification in Mytilus mussels (Bivalvia: Mytilidae) inferred from chromosomal mapping of rRNA and histone gene clusters ArchiMer
Perez Garcia, Maria Concepcion; Moran, Paloma; Pasantes, Juan J..
Background: Mussels of the genus Mytilus present morphologically similar karyotypes that are presumably conserved. The absence of chromosome painting probes in bivalves makes difficult verifying this hypothesis. In this context, we comparatively mapped ribosomal RNA and histone gene families on the chromosomes of Mytilus edulis, M. galloprovincialis, M. trossulus and M. californianus by fluorescent in situ hybridization (FISH). Results: Major rRNA, core and linker histone gene clusters mapped to different chromosome pairs in the four taxa. In contrast, minor rRNA gene clusters showed a different behavior. In all Mytilus two of the 5S rDNA clusters mapped to the same chromosome pair and one of them showed overlapping signals with those corresponding to one...

Large scale distribution of bacterial communities in the upper Paraná River floodplain BJM
Chiaramonte,Josiane Barros; Roberto,Maria do Carmo; Pagioro,Thomaz Aurélio.
A bacterial community has a central role in nutrient cycle in aquatic habitats. Therefore, it is important to analyze how this community is distributed throughout different locations. Thirty-six different sites in the upper Paraná River floodplain were surveyed to determine the influence of environmental variable in bacterial community composition. The sites are classified as rivers, channels, and floodplain lakes connected or unconnected to the main river channel. The bacterial community structure was analyzed by fluorescent in situ hybridization (FISH) technique, based on frequency of the main domains Bacteria and Archaea, and subdivisions of the phylum Proteobacteria (Alpha-proteobacteria, Beta-proteobacteria, Gamma-proteobacteria) and the...

Molecular detection of the oyster parasite Mikrocytos mackini, and a preliminary phylogenetic analysis ArchiMer
Carnegie, Ryan; Meyer, Gary; Blackbourn, Janice; Cochennec, Nathalie; Berthe, Franck; Bower, Susan.
The protistan parasite Mikrocytos mackini, the causative agent of Denman Island disease in the oyster Crassostrea gigas in British Columbia, Canada, is of wide concern because it can infect other oyster species and because its life cycle, mode of transmission, and origins are unknown. PCR and fluorescent in situ hybridization (FISH) assays were developed for M mackini, the PCR assay was validated against standard histopathological diagnosis, and a preliminary phylogenetic analysis of the M mackini small-subunit ribosomal RNA gene (SSU rDNA) was undertaken. A PCR designed specifically not to amplify host DNA generated a 544 bp SSU rDNA fragment from M mackini-infected oysters and enriched M. mackini cell isolates, but not from uninfected control oysters....

Occurrence of Listeria monocytogenes in silages assessed by fluorescent in situ hybridization Arq. Bras. Med. Vet. Zootec.
Oliveira,M.; Guerra,M.; Bernardo,F..
Avaliou-se a qualidade microbiológica da silagem produzida em Portugal e otimizaram-se alguns aspectos relacionados com a eficácia de detecção de Listeria monocytogenes mediante protocolo baseado na técnica de hibridação in situ fluorescente (FISH) para detecção directa desse microrganismo em amostras de silagens. O protocolo foi aplicado a 74 amostras, em simultâneo com o método bacteriológico convencional. Este último permitiu a detecção de L. monocytogenes em 11 silos (15%). Por meio do protocolo FISH, observou-se que 22 silos (29,7%) se encontravam contaminados. O método FISH apresentou precisão (77,0%), especificidade (92,5%) e sensibilidade (72,7%) elevadas, sendo adequado para a análise microbiológica presuntiva de silagens, uma vez que é um método...
